Def Jam banks on Southeast Asia rap stars
WHEN Singapore’s Yung Raja remixed Gucci Gang by US rapper Lil Pump, he swapped the original’s flashy cars and a prowling tiger for a beer can and Tamil food in a viral YouTube video that reeled in hip-hop label Def Jam.
